THIS book is the latest representative of a series of short lecture-monographs. The title would seem to be rather grandiloquent for a work of this type; but, in fact, the author has managed to consider, albeit superficially, most of the reactions and transformations of this important class of organic compounds.
The Chemistry of Acetylene and related Compounds
By Ernst David Bergmann. (Polytechnic Institute of Brooklyn: Lectures on Progress in Chemistry.) Pp. vii + 108. (New York and London: Interscience Publishers, Inc., 1948.) 18s.
